DBA Data[Home] [Help]

PACKAGE: APPS.PER_RI_CONFIG_FND_HR_ENTITY

Source


1 PACKAGE per_ri_config_fnd_hr_entity AS
2 /* $Header: perrichd.pkh 120.2.12000000.1 2007/01/22 03:39:40 appldev noship $ */
3 
4   TYPE security_profile_rec IS RECORD (security_profile_name   varchar2(60)
5                                       ,responsibility_key      varchar2(60));
6 
7   TYPE security_profile_tab IS TABLE OF
8       security_profile_rec
9   INDEX BY BINARY_INTEGER;
10 
11   TYPE int_bg_resp_rec IS RECORD (security_profile_name   varchar2(60)
12                                  ,responsibility_key      varchar2(60));
13 
14   TYPE int_bg_resp_tab IS TABLE OF
15       int_bg_resp_rec
16   INDEX BY BINARY_INTEGER;
17 
18   l_security_profile_tab              security_profile_tab;
19   l_security_profile_tab              security_profile_tab;
20 
21 
22   PROCEDURE create_global_grp_cmp_cost_kf
23               (p_configuration_code           in  varchar2
24               ,p_technical_summary_mode       in  boolean default FALSE
25               ,p_kf_grp_tab                   in out nocopy per_ri_config_tech_summary.kf_grp_tab
26               ,p_kf_cmp_tab                   in out nocopy per_ri_config_tech_summary.kf_cmp_tab
27               ,p_kf_cost_tab                  in out nocopy per_ri_config_tech_summary.kf_cost_tab
28               ,p_kf_grp_seg_tab               in out nocopy per_ri_config_tech_summary.kf_grp_seg_tab
29               ,p_kf_cmp_seg_tab               in out nocopy per_ri_config_tech_summary.kf_cmp_seg_tab
30               ,p_kf_cost_seg_tab              in out nocopy per_ri_config_tech_summary.kf_cost_seg_tab
31               );
32 
33   PROCEDURE create_global_job_pos_kf (p_configuration_code in varchar2
34                                      ,p_technical_summary_mode in boolean default FALSE
35                                      ,p_kf_job_tab in out nocopy
36                                                per_ri_config_tech_summary.kf_job_tab
37                                      ,p_kf_pos_tab in out nocopy
38                                                per_ri_config_tech_summary.kf_pos_tab
39                                      ,p_kf_job_seg_tab in out nocopy
40                                                per_ri_config_tech_summary.kf_job_seg_tab
41                                      ,p_kf_pos_seg_tab in out nocopy
42                                                per_ri_config_tech_summary.kf_pos_seg_tab);
43 
44   PROCEDURE create_global_pos_kf (p_configuration_code in varchar2
45                                  ,p_technical_summary_mode in boolean default FALSE
46                                  ,p_kf_pos_tab in out nocopy
47                                            per_ri_config_tech_summary.kf_pos_tab
48                                  ,p_kf_pos_seg_tab in out nocopy
49                                            per_ri_config_tech_summary.kf_pos_seg_tab);
50 
51   PROCEDURE create_global_grd_kf (p_configuration_code in varchar2
52                                  ,p_technical_summary_mode in boolean default FALSE
53                                  ,p_kf_grd_tab in out nocopy
54                                                per_ri_config_tech_summary.kf_grd_tab
55                                  ,p_kf_grd_seg_tab in out nocopy
56                                                per_ri_config_tech_summary.kf_grd_seg_tab);
57 
58   PROCEDURE create_default_value_sets (p_configuration_code in varchar2);
59 
60  PROCEDURE create_hrms_responsibility (p_configuration_code   in varchar2
61                                       ,p_security_profile_tab in out nocopy security_profile_tab
62                                       ,p_technical_summary_mode in boolean default FALSE
63                                       ,p_hrms_resp_tab in out nocopy
64                                          per_ri_config_tech_summary.hrms_resp_tab);
65 
66   PROCEDURE create_jobs_rv_keyflex (p_configuration_code in varchar2
67                                    ,p_technical_summary_mode in boolean default FALSE
68                                    ,p_kf_job_rv_tab in out nocopy
69                                                per_ri_config_tech_summary.kf_job_rv_tab
70                                    ,p_kf_job_rv_seg_tab in out nocopy
71                                                per_ri_config_tech_summary.kf_job_rv_seg_tab);
72 
73   PROCEDURE create_positions_rv_keyflex (p_configuration_code in varchar2
74                                         ,p_technical_summary_mode in boolean default FALSE
75                                         ,p_kf_pos_rv_tab in out nocopy
76                                                per_ri_config_tech_summary.kf_pos_rv_tab
77                                         ,p_kf_pos_rv_seg_tab in out nocopy
78                                                per_ri_config_tech_summary.kf_pos_rv_seg_tab);
79 
80   PROCEDURE create_grades_rv_keyflex (p_configuration_code in varchar2
81                                      ,p_technical_summary_mode in boolean default FALSE
82                                      ,p_kf_grd_rv_tab in out nocopy
83                                                per_ri_config_tech_summary.kf_grd_rv_tab
84                                      ,p_kf_grd_rv_seg_tab in out nocopy
85                                                per_ri_config_tech_summary.kf_grd_rv_seg_tab);
86 
87   PROCEDURE create_jobs_no_rv_keyflex (p_configuration_code in varchar2
88                                       ,p_technical_summary_mode in boolean default FALSE
89                                       ,p_kf_job_no_rv_tab in out nocopy
90                                                per_ri_config_tech_summary.kf_job_no_rv_tab
91                                       ,p_kf_job_no_rv_seg_tab in out nocopy
92                                                per_ri_config_tech_summary.kf_job_no_rv_seg_tab);
93 
94   PROCEDURE create_positions_no_rv_keyflex (p_configuration_code in varchar2
95                                            ,p_technical_summary_mode in boolean default FALSE
96                                            ,p_kf_pos_no_rv_tab in out nocopy
97                                                per_ri_config_tech_summary.kf_pos_no_rv_tab
98                                       ,p_kf_pos_no_rv_seg_tab in out nocopy
99                                                per_ri_config_tech_summary.kf_pos_no_rv_seg_tab);
100 
101   PROCEDURE create_grades_no_rv_keyflex (p_configuration_code in varchar2
102                                         ,p_technical_summary_mode in boolean default FALSE
103                                         ,p_kf_grd_no_rv_tab in out nocopy
104                                                per_ri_config_tech_summary.kf_grd_no_rv_tab
105                                         ,p_kf_grd_no_rv_seg_tab in out nocopy
106                                                per_ri_config_tech_summary.kf_grd_no_rv_seg_tab);
107 
108   PROCEDURE create_application_level_resp(p_configuration_code     in varchar2
109                                          ,p_technical_summary_mode in boolean default FALSE
110                                          ,p_profile_apps_tab       in out nocopy
111                                                  per_ri_config_tech_summary.profile_apps_tab);
112 
113 
114   PROCEDURE create_resp_level_profile(p_configuration_code  in varchar2
115                                      ,p_responsibility_key  in varchar2
116                                      ,p_technical_summary_mode in boolean default FALSE
117                                      ,p_profile_resp_tab    in out nocopy
118                                                                per_ri_config_tech_summary.profile_resp_tab);
119 
120     PROCEDURE create_bg_id_and_sg_id_profile(p_configuration_code    in varchar2
121                                           ,p_responsibility_key    in varchar2
122                                           ,p_business_group_name   in varchar2
123                                           ,p_technical_summary_mode  in boolean default FALSE
124                                           ,p_bg_sg_ut_profile_resp_tab in out nocopy
125                                                        per_ri_config_tech_summary.profile_resp_tab);
126 
127 END per_ri_config_fnd_hr_entity;
128